New Maserati Ghibli Leaks UPDATED: Now Official
Tue, 09 Apr 2013The new Maserati Ghibli – the new, smaller version of the Quattroporte – has leaked ahead of a reveal later this week and a debut at the Shanghai Motor Show. Update: Maserati has now officially revealed the Ghibli with the same three photos we published. Apart from the information below, the only other confirmation is that the new Maserati Ghibli will also be offered with the first diesel engine in a Maserati, allowing it to compete with cars like the Audi A6 and the Jaguar XF 3.0 litre Diesel S.
VW Up 5 Door reveal
Mon, 23 Jan 2012VW Up 5 Door The first photos of the VW Up 5 door have been revealed, a few months after the 3-Door Up debuted officially at the Frankfurt Motor Show. The 3-Door VW Up debuted at the Frankfurt Motor Show back in September, but instead of being the radical departure we were expecting, it turned out to be just a replacement for the VW Lupo. And now we get the first photos of the VW Up 5-Door, which will broaden the appeal of the Up!
Car Design of the Year winners awarded at Car Design Night Geneva 2013
Mon, 11 Mar 2013The winners of the 2012 Car Design of the Year Awards, as voted for by Car Design News readers, were announced at the annual Car Design Night at By Pass nightclub on the evening of the first Geneva motor show press day. Over 350 car designers were in attendance to catch up with their colleagues and meet new peers at the first European show of the year. Car Design News' editor, Owen Ready, presented the winners of the annual Car Design of the Year Awards.
